James is a senior offensive lineman from Deerfield Beach, Florida, who committed to Alabama in January 2026 with two years of eligibility remaining. He began his career at Akron, spent two seasons there and then moved to Mississippi State, where he started 12 games in 2025 including nine at left tackle. A three-star recruit out of Blanche Ely High School in the 2023 class, he is listed at 6-5 and 320 pounds and gives the Crimson Tide an experienced option on the edge of the offensive line.

NIL at Alabama Crimson Tide

Alabama competes in the SEC and runs one of the highest-revenue athletic departments in the country, which shapes its NIL market. Since the House settlement took effect in 2025, the school can share revenue directly with athletes, roughly $20.5 million across all sports in the first year with the cap rising annually, and football is widely expected to receive the largest share. Third-party deals continue alongside those payments, coordinated in part through Yea Alabama, the NIL entity the athletic department launched in 2023. Football stars command the program's top valuations, while basketball, gymnastics and other sports draw smaller deals. Alabama's national brand, television exposure and large alumni base keep its overall NIL economy among the strongest in college sports.

How NIL value is calculated

An NIL value is an estimate of what an athlete could earn from name, image and likeness over 12 months, not a salary or a confirmed deal. We weigh audience (social reach and engagement), performance and role, school and market, and the sport and position.
